Have banded/widened rims on my citi golf. problem is surface rust. best way to get rid of it to prep them for spraying. the dude had those moon caps on and basically they have rust because he was riding with the moon hubs for a year+
Just looking for the best way to sand and prep for spraying without the used of sand blasting (working on a budget)
Guessing the good old fashion way of elbow grease,but need a guide for sanding and prepping. which grid sandpaper to use,how to make best use with low budget and time saving.
spraying them white if that makes any difference, cooilo cheers.

Re: Sanding and preping for spraying rims
What Alron said, if they are really bad, start with something like 320 and go up from there. I like to use a decent etch primer if you are going to sand down to the bare metal just to make sure the paint sticks properly
